[AI-assisted] feat: Implement comprehensive PyPI release pipeline with safety checks #8
ci.yml
on: pull_request
Matrix: Linting and Type Checking
Matrix: Tests
Security Scanning
30s
Performance Tests
45s
Matrix: Cross-Platform Integration Tests
Test PyPI Publishing (TestPyPI)
0s
Notify
4s
Publish to PyPI (Production)
0s
Annotations
1 warning
|
Cross-Platform Integration Tests (macos-latest, 3.11)
No available formula with the name "unrar". Did you mean unar?
|
Artifacts
Produced during runtime
| Name | Size | Digest | |
|---|---|---|---|
|
benchmark-results
Expired
|
144 Bytes |
sha256:cf1c92e57acac5577e6da57abfbd4389471ca88e0621dd563fdd7293b28f5a32
|
|
|
coverage-report
Expired
|
412 KB |
sha256:df63b7c3bbf5b921aa4848cce8c867691f6c5a0e9e91469ea19e236dbc8905c9
|
|
|
dist-packages
Expired
|
230 KB |
sha256:51fae8b27230abea56990914b05c7640fef4314f937cd5e5916acea60089fdf0
|
|
|
integration-artifacts-macos-latest-py3.11
Expired
|
409 Bytes |
sha256:cfd663d94d49cdf027bb9ef9c3bef4fe9d17a350a412806b6889c7b1f740ab58
|
|
|
integration-artifacts-ubuntu-latest-py3.11
Expired
|
409 Bytes |
sha256:4275fb2989dca063194c338713cc6672fe454a8c986291ccf57a3d758ce328eb
|
|
|
integration-artifacts-windows-latest-py3.11
Expired
|
347 Bytes |
sha256:ec779d751517eeac48282d95da6a6ab367fa864b87a88d9362eb1000be5c47e1
|
|
|
security-reports
Expired
|
2.46 KB |
sha256:6a604c4fc509a7b11b0f16eb95f4895fb2375757f09db6d4fbbf040f3f917c29
|
|